Scholieren.com forum

Scholieren.com forum (https://forum.scholieren.com/index.php)
-   Software & Hardware (https://forum.scholieren.com/forumdisplay.php?f=20)
-   -   [visual basic/excel] (https://forum.scholieren.com/showthread.php?t=270741)

Ik/Slaughterer 06-11-2002 08:01

[visual basic/excel]
 
Ik ben bezig met een macro te maken voor Excel.
De code die ik nu heb is:

Charts.Add
ActiveChart.ChartType = xlXYScatterSmoothNoMarkers
ActiveChart.SetSourceData Source:=Sheets("data").Range("A1")
ActiveChart.SeriesCollection.NewSeries
ActiveChart.SeriesCollection.NewSeries
ActiveChart.SeriesCollection.NewSeries
ActiveChart.SeriesCollection(1).XValues = "=data!deel1.1"
ActiveChart.SeriesCollection(1).Values = "=data!deel1.2"
ActiveChart.SeriesCollection(2).XValues = "=data!deel2.1"
ActiveChart.SeriesCollection(2).Values = "=data!deel2.2"
ActiveChart.SeriesCollection(3).XValues = "=data!deel3.1"
ActiveChart.SeriesCollection(3).Values = "=data!deel3.2"
ActiveChart.Location Where:=xlLocationAsNewSheet, Name:="grafiek"


Hoe kan je zorgen dat je het bereik van een series kan samenvatten in 1 gedefineerd bereik, in plaats van 2 zoals nu het geval is.

Nog een stukje code:

ActiveChart.SeriesCollection(1).Select
ActiveChart.SeriesCollection(1).Trendlines.Add(Type:=xlLinear, Forward:=4, _
Backward:=0, DisplayEquation:=True, DisplayRSquared:=True).Select

Hoe kan je zorgen dat met behulp van een macro de a en b van de formule van de trendlijn apart in een veld in excel verschijnen? (ax+b=y)


Alle tijden zijn GMT +1. Het is nu 22:55.

Powered by vBulletin® Version 3.8.8
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.